Vault of Seekers (VOS) is an innovative open-source project designed to streamline access to multiple popular AI APIs within a single application. This unification allows users to harness the strengths of various AI models, making it easier to conduct research and gather insights. Instead of relying on a single AI provider, VOS empowers users to compare and analyze results from different sources, enhancing the overall quality and reliability of the information obtained.

VOS offers a range of features that make it a powerful tool for anyone interested in AI research. Users can choose from various search modes, including Standard, Multi-Source, and Summary, allowing them to tailor their queries based on their specific needs. The app also includes a Conflict Check feature, which helps identify inconsistencies in responses from different AI models. Additionally, VOS allows users to organize their searches into projects, manage their history, and even configure their API keys for a personalized experience.
